云服务器写入权限设置错误导致网站无法更新内容的解决方案
在使用云服务器的过程中,我们可能会遇到由于写入权限设置错误而造成网站无法更新内容的问题。这种问题不仅影响用户体验,还会给网站运营带来不便。今天我们就来探讨一下这个问题的解决方法。
一、检查文件及文件夹权限
首先要确保相关目录和文件具有正确的权限。以 Linux 为例,一般情况下,Apache 或 Nginx 的工作用户是 www-data(也可能是其他用户名,具体取决于安装配置)。我们需要将这些文件夹或文件的所有者设置为该用户,以便让其能够对指定位置进行读取与写入操作。
还需确认目标路径是否被赋予了适当的访问权限。对于需要上传图片、保存缓存等场景,对应的文件夹通常应拥有可写的权限;而对于只允许读取的静态资源,则只需授予读取权限即可。
二、排查服务器配置文件
如果已经正确设置了文件系统权限但问题依旧存在,那么可能是因为 Web 服务器本身没有配置好相应的权限。这时可以查看 Apache 或 Nginx 的配置文件中关于特定站点的部分,寻找类似 AllowOverride、DirectoryIndex 等关键字,确保它们不会限制某些类型的请求或者阻止对某些路径的访问。
三、联系技术支持团队
如果您尝试了上述步骤后仍然无法解决问题,建议您尽快联系云服务提供商的技术支持团队寻求帮助。他们拥有更多专业知识,并且可以直接访问您的服务器环境进行诊断。请准备好详细的错误信息以及之前所做的更改记录,这有助于加快解决问题的速度。
四、预防措施
为了避免未来再次出现类似的权限问题,在日常维护过程中要注意以下几点:
- 定期备份重要数据并记录每次变更的内容;
- 遵循最小化原则分配权限,即只给予必要的权限,避免过度授权;
- 保持软件版本更新,及时修复已知的安全漏洞;
- 学习相关知识,提高自身技术水平。
通过以上措施,我们可以有效地应对由云服务器写入权限设置错误引发的网站无法更新内容的问题。希望这篇文章能给您提供一些参考价值。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/46818.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。